I am have trouble staying connected on my mobile device to the T-mobile router. My phone wont stay connected to the wifi. Has anyone out there experienced a similar issue ? 

I am using a Google Pixel 4a

If you're experiencing trouble staying connected to your T-Mobile Home Internet router on your Google Pixel 4a, there are a few steps you can take to troubleshoot the issue:

1. Check Wi-Fi Signal Strength: Ensure that you are within a reasonable range of your T-Mobile router and that the Wi-Fi signal strength is strong. Walls, distance, and interference from other devices can weaken the signal. Try moving closer to the router or relocating it to a more central location in your home.

2. Restart Router and Phone: Power cycle both your T-Mobile router and your Google Pixel 4a. Turn off the router, wait for a few seconds, and then turn it back on. Similarly, restart your phone by turning it off and then on again. This can help refresh the network connections.

3. Forget and Reconnect to Wi-Fi Network: On your Google Pixel 4a, go to Settings > Wi-Fi, find your T-Mobile Wi-Fi network, and select it. Tap "Forget" to remove the network. Then, scan for available networks, select your T-Mobile Wi-Fi, and enter the password to reconnect. This can help establish a fresh connection.

4. Reset Network Settings: If the issue persists, you can try resetting the network settings on your Google Pixel 4a. Go to Settings > System > Reset options > Reset Wi-Fi, mobile & Bluetooth. Keep in mind that this will remove all saved Wi-Fi networks and Bluetooth pairings, so you'll need to set them up again.

5. Update Software: Ensure that your Google Pixel 4a has the latest software updates installed. New updates often include bug fixes and improvements that can address connectivity issues. Go to Settings > System > Advanced > System update to check for any available updates.

If the problem continues after trying these steps, it's recommended to contact T-Mobile customer support. They can provide more specific assistance based on your T-Mobile Home Internet setup and any known issues in your area.
